The battery life on my W810i seems no worse than my W800i, although I accept the official figures do say otherwise.

The fact the screen shuts off so quickly might explain why you can still get exceptional standby times - and it's possibly the only minor annoyance on the phone. There's no option to keep the screen on (showing the clock) even with a warning that it will impact battery life.

I guess the screen consumes a lot more power than the old one. Still, an option would be nice as I would rather charge it more often than have to keep pressing 'back up' to get the screen back on after I stopped to blink.

There's enough new stuff on the W810i to make it my phone of choice between the K750, W800 and W810.

The W810i has a vastly superior screen (colour wise, and size). The resolution may be the same, but you will see what I mean if you compare the two.

The W810i also has EDGE (useful for Orange users in the UK), the update service, NetFront web browser, Flash Lite, RSS newsreader, phonebook backup to MS and the camera is like that of the W900i - meaning little to no 'blue streaks' in low light images - my only complaint about the W800/K750 really.

Finally, it has both a Walkman button AND a shortcut key - the best of both worlds.

Therefore, given the choice I'd go for a W810i each and every time. In fact, it's probably the best 'all-rounder' from SE at the moment - as long as you can live without 3G.
